![]() Many consider the Ducktail a perfect compromise between the wild characteristic of having a beard and well-groomed sophistication. The Ducktail beard style is another take on the original full beard and gets its name from its appearance.īy looking at it, you can quickly see how much the bottom part of this beard style resembles a duck's tail. Guys with square or round faces should grow fuller beards on the chin with shorter sides to help lengthen their faces. Men with oblong or rectangular faces should grow a beard with more hair on the sides while keeping the length on the chin shorter to balance out their features. Like sunglasses or hats, different beard styles work better with different face shapes, so it's essential to pick the right one for you.
